Magnificent & Modest Walking Tour of Milton

Third Saturday of the month May – October, 10 am (May 15, June 19, July 17, Aug 21, Sept 18, Oct 16). Join Milton Historical Society staff and volunteers for a walking tour of the town once known as, “Head of Broadkill.” Milton enjoys a rich architectural heritage, with 198 structures listed on the National Register of Historic Places. The tour will review the town’s early history and include a lively discussion the ship captains and seafaring men who called Milton home. A broad range of architectural styles will be featured including: Colonial, Federal, Greek Revival, Gothic Revival, Italianate, Queen Anne, Colonial Revival and Bungalow. Attention will also be given to the regional folk or vernacular tradition of building found throughout the town. Button sheds, barns, and outbuildings will be discussed as the tour winds through side lanes and alleys. The tour will last approximately 1 ˝ hours and covers a little over a mile. Sturdy shoes, plenty of sun block, and hats are recommended. Weather permitting.
